Last night I was using a new cloth strop and my J.A. Henkels 78 1/2 got a small chip in it and was scratching my leather strop. Don't know how. Well I then got a chance to use my stones for my first honing session. Norton 1k to set my bevel, Norton 4k/8k, and finishing with my naniwa 12k, diamond spray, 50 cloth strops and 75 leather. Didn't pass a HHT but it did shave like a dream, no irritation no weepers just a plain BBS shave. I just did a alot of reading on bevel setting and I believe I did set the bevel correctly.
